Cotter Road duplication road resurfacing continues


Released 02/03/2018

Motorists are advised that Cotter Road will be reduced to one lane eastbound from Monday 5 March 2018 so work to resurface the road can be completed.

One lane of Cotter Road between the Equestrian club and Yarralumla Creek (about 300 metres) will be closed to traffic after the morning peak period on Monday 5 March and will reopen for the morning peak period on Wednesday 7 March 2018.

“One eastbound lane will remain open to traffic, while the other lane is closed for approximately 300 metres so important asphalting works can be completed,” said Ben McHugh, Director of Capital Works and Development Support, Transport Canberra and City Services.

“The ACT Government apologises for the inconvenience and thanks everyone for their patience whilst this important work takes place.”

The duplication of Cotter Road between McCulloch Street and Streeton Drive remains on track to be completed in April 2018 (weather permitting). Once complete, this upgrade will significantly increase traffic capacity and safety for drivers and other road users.

Traffic controllers as well as warning signs will alert people to the changed traffic arrangements. Drivers are asked to be mindful of the changed traffic arrangements and adhere to the work zone speed limits.
